Belia Syampur - Bhagawangola - I, Murshidabad

Belia Syampur is a village situated in the Bhagawangola - I subdivision of Murshidabad district, West Bengal. Bhagawangola serves as the Gram Panchayat for Belia Syampur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Belia Syampur is 314441. The village covers a total geographical area of 341.34 hectares and falls under the 742135 pincode. Jiaganj is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.

Belia Syampur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bhagabangola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Murshidabad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Belia Syampur

As per Census 2011, Belia Syampur village has a total population of 11,847 people, consisting of 6,060 males and 5,787 females. The village has 2,780 households and a sex ratio of 954 females per 1,000 males. There are 1,467 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 7,362 literate and 4,485 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,082 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 9 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Belia Syampur

Belia Syampur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Pirtala, while the nearest airport is Malda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 63.7 km.
